A Modular Stack refers to the way modular building units are arranged and connected vertically in modular construction projects. It's like stacking building blocks, where individual pre-built rooms or sections (modules) are placed on top of each other to create multi-story buildings. This method is popular in construction because it allows for faster building assembly on-site, since most of the work is done in factories. You might also hear it called "module stacking," "vertical modular assembly," or "stacked modular construction."

Q: How do you manage quality control in a modular stack project with multiple stories?
Expected Answer: A senior professional should discuss inspection protocols at both factory and site levels, connection verification processes, waterproofing between modules, and coordination between manufacturing and on-site teams.
Q: What are the key considerations when planning a modular stack project timeline?
Expected Answer: Should explain factory production scheduling, transportation logistics, crane availability, weather considerations, and how to coordinate various teams including factory workers, transporters, and on-site assembly crews.
Q: What are the main challenges in connecting modules in a vertical stack?
Expected Answer: Should discuss alignment techniques, weather protection during assembly, proper connection methods between modules, and coordination of mechanical/electrical systems between units.
Q: How do you ensure proper structural integrity in a modular stack?
Expected Answer: Should explain load calculations, importance of proper foundation preparation, module connection verification, and understanding of building codes specific to modular construction.
Q: What basic safety procedures are important during module stacking?
Expected Answer: Should mention personal protective equipment requirements, communication with crane operators, weather monitoring, and basic site safety protocols.
Q: Describe the typical process of stacking modules on-site.
Expected Answer: Should explain the basic sequence of delivery, preparation, crane lifting, placement, and initial connection of modules in a simple project.
